The Lord’s Covenant with David, and Israel’s Afflictions.

A [a]Maskil of [b]Ethan [c]the Ezrahite.

89 I will (A)sing of the lovingkindness of the Lord forever;
To all generations I will (B)make known Your (C)faithfulness with my mouth.
For I have said, “(D)Lovingkindness will be built up forever;
In the heavens You will establish Your (E)faithfulness.”
“I have made a covenant with (F)My chosen;
I have (G)sworn to David My servant,
I will establish your (H)seed forever
And build up your (I)throne to all generations.” [d]Selah.

The (J)heavens will praise Your wonders, O Lord;
Your faithfulness also (K)in the assembly of the (L)holy ones.
For (M)who in the skies is comparable to the Lord?
Who among the [e](N)sons of the mighty is like the Lord,
A God (O)greatly feared in the council of the (P)holy ones,
And (Q)awesome above all those who are around Him?
O Lord God of hosts, (R)who is like You, O mighty [f]Lord?
Your faithfulness also surrounds You.
You rule the swelling of the sea;
When its waves rise, You (S)still them.
10 You Yourself crushed [g](T)Rahab like one who is slain;
You (U)scattered Your enemies with [h]Your mighty arm.

11 The (V)heavens are Yours, the earth also is Yours;
The (W)world and [i]all it contains, You have founded them.
12 The (X)north and the south, You have created them;
(Y)Tabor and (Z)Hermon (AA)shout for joy at Your name.
13 You have [j]a strong arm;
Your hand is mighty, Your (AB)right hand is exalted.
14 (AC)Righteousness and justice are the foundation of Your throne;
(AD)Lovingkindness and [k]truth go before You.
15 How blessed are the people who know the [l](AE)joyful sound!
O Lord, they walk in the (AF)light of Your countenance.
16 In (AG)Your name they rejoice all the day,
And by Your righteousness they are exalted.
17 For You are the glory of (AH)their strength,
And by Your favor [m]our (AI)horn is exalted.
18 For our (AJ)shield belongs to the Lord,
[n]And our king to the (AK)Holy One of Israel.

19 [o]Once You spoke in vision to Your godly [p]ones,
And said, “I have [q]given help to one who is (AL)mighty;
I have exalted one (AM)chosen from the people.
20 “I have (AN)found David My servant;
With My holy (AO)oil I have anointed him,
21 With whom (AP)My hand will be established;
My arm also will (AQ)strengthen him.
22 “The enemy will not [r]deceive him,
Nor the [s](AR)son of wickedness afflict him.
23 “But I shall (AS)crush his adversaries before him,
And strike those who hate him.
24 “My (AT)faithfulness and My lovingkindness will be with him,
And in My name his (AU)horn will be exalted.
25 “I shall also set his hand (AV)on the sea
And his right hand on the rivers.
26 “He will cry to Me, ‘You are (AW)my Father,
My God, and the (AX)rock of my salvation.’
27 “I also shall make him My (AY)firstborn,
The (AZ)highest of the kings of the earth.
28 “My (BA)lovingkindness I will keep for him forever,
And My (BB)covenant shall be confirmed to him.
29 “So I will establish his [t](BC)descendants forever
And his (BD)throne (BE)as the days of heaven.

30 “If his sons (BF)forsake My law
And do not walk in My judgments,
31 If they [u]violate My statutes
And do not keep My commandments,
32 Then I will punish their transgression with the (BG)rod
And their iniquity with stripes.
33 “But I will not break off (BH)My lovingkindness from him,
Nor deal falsely in My faithfulness.
34 “My (BI)covenant I will not [v]violate,
Nor will I (BJ)alter [w]the utterance of My lips.
35 [x]Once I have (BK)sworn by My holiness;
I will not lie to David.
36 “His [y](BL)descendants shall endure forever
And his (BM)throne (BN)as the sun before Me.
37 “It shall be established forever (BO)like the moon,
And the (BP)witness in the sky is faithful.” [z]Selah.

38 But You have (BQ)cast off and (BR)rejected,
You have been full of wrath [aa]against Your (BS)anointed.
39 You have (BT)spurned the covenant of Your servant;
You have (BU)profaned (BV)his crown [ab]in the dust.
40 You have (BW)broken down all his walls;
You have (BX)brought his strongholds to ruin.
41 (BY)All who pass along the way plunder him;
He has become a (BZ)reproach to his neighbors.
42 You have (CA)exalted the right hand of his adversaries;
You have (CB)made all his enemies rejoice.
43 You also turn back the edge of his sword
And have (CC)not made him stand in battle.
44 You have made his [ac](CD)splendor to cease
And cast his throne to the ground.
45 You have (CE)shortened the days of his youth;
You have (CF)covered him with shame. Selah.

46 (CG)How long, O Lord?
Will You hide Yourself forever?
Will Your (CH)wrath burn like fire?
47 (CI)Remember [ad]what my span of life is;
For what (CJ)vanity [ae]You have created all the sons of men!
48 What man can live and not (CK)see death?
Can he (CL)deliver his soul from the [af]power of [ag]Sheol? Selah.

49 Where are Your former lovingkindnesses, O Lord,
Which You (CM)swore to David in Your faithfulness?
50 Remember, O Lord, the (CN)reproach of Your servants;
[ah]How I bear in my bosom the reproach of all the many peoples,
51 With which (CO)Your enemies have reproached, O Lord,
With which they have reproached the footsteps of (CP)Your anointed.

52 (CQ)Blessed be the Lord forever!
Amen and Amen.

God’s Eternity and Man’s Transitoriness.

A Prayer of [ai]Moses, the man of God.

90 Lord, You have been our [aj](CR)dwelling place in all generations.
Before (CS)the mountains were born
[ak]Or You (CT)gave birth to the earth and the world,
Even (CU)from everlasting to everlasting, You are God.

You (CV)turn man back into dust
And say, “Return, O children of men.”
For (CW)a thousand years in Your sight
Are like (CX)yesterday when it passes by,
[al]Or as a (CY)watch in the night.
You (CZ)have [am]swept them away like a flood, they [an](DA)fall asleep;
In the morning they are like (DB)grass which [ao]sprouts anew.
In the morning it (DC)flourishes and [ap]sprouts anew;
Toward evening it (DD)fades and (DE)withers away.

For we have been (DF)consumed by Your anger
And by Your wrath we have been [aq]dismayed.
You have (DG)placed our iniquities before You,
Our (DH)secret sins in the light of Your presence.
For (DI)all our days have declined in Your fury;
We have finished our years like a [ar]sigh.
10 As for the days of our [as]life, [at]they contain seventy years,
Or if due to strength, (DJ)eighty years,
Yet their pride is but (DK)labor and sorrow;
For soon it is gone and we (DL)fly away.
11 Who [au]understands the (DM)power of Your anger
And Your fury, according to the (DN)fear [av]that is due You?
12 So (DO)teach us to number our days,
That we may [aw](DP)present to You a heart of wisdom.

13 Do (DQ)return, O Lord; (DR)how long will it be?
And [ax]be (DS)sorry for Your servants.
14 O (DT)satisfy us in the morning with Your lovingkindness,
That we may (DU)sing for joy and be glad all our days.
15 (DV)Make us glad [ay]according to the days You have afflicted us,
And the (DW)years we have seen [az]evil.
16 Let Your (DX)work appear to Your servants
And Your (DY)majesty [ba]to their children.
17 Let the (DZ)favor of the Lord our God be upon us;
And [bb](EA)confirm for us the work of our hands;
Yes, [bc]confirm the work of our hands.

Security of the One Who Trusts in the Lord.

91 He who dwells in the (EB)shelter of the Most High
Will abide in the (EC)shadow of the Almighty.
I will say to the Lord, “My (ED)refuge and my (EE)fortress,
My God, in whom I (EF)trust!”
For it is He who delivers you from the (EG)snare of the trapper
And from the deadly (EH)pestilence.
He will (EI)cover you with His pinions,
And (EJ)under His wings you may seek refuge;
His (EK)faithfulness is a (EL)shield and bulwark.

You (EM)will not be afraid of the (EN)terror by night,
Or of the (EO)arrow that flies by day;
Of the (EP)pestilence that [bd]stalks in darkness,
Or of the (EQ)destruction that lays waste at noon.
A thousand may fall at your side
And ten thousand at your right hand,
But (ER)it shall not approach you.
You will only look on with your eyes
And (ES)see the recompense of the wicked.
[be]For you have made the Lord, (ET)my refuge,
Even the Most High, (EU)your dwelling place.
10 (EV)No evil will befall you,
Nor will any plague come near your [bf]tent.

11 For He will give (EW)His angels charge concerning you,
To guard you in all your ways.
12 They will (EX)bear you up in their hands,
That you do not strike your foot against a stone.
13 You will (EY)tread upon the lion and cobra,
The young lion and the [bg]serpent you will trample down.

14 (EZ)Because he has loved Me, therefore I will deliver him;
I will (FA)set him securely on high, because he has (FB)known My name.
15 “He will (FC)call upon Me, and I will answer him;
I will be with him in [bh]trouble;
I will rescue him and (FD)honor him.
16 “With [bi]a (FE)long life I will satisfy him
And [bj](FF)let him see My salvation.”

Praise for the Lord’s Goodness.

A Psalm, a Song for the Sabbath day.

92 It is (FG)good to give thanks to the Lord
And to (FH)sing praises to Your name, O Most High;
To (FI)declare Your lovingkindness in the morning
And Your (FJ)faithfulness [bk]by night,
[bl]With the (FK)ten-stringed lute and [bm]with the (FL)harp,
[bn]With resounding music [bo]upon the (FM)lyre.
For You, O Lord, have made me glad by [bp]what You (FN)have done,
I will (FO)sing for joy at the (FP)works of Your hands.

How (FQ)great are Your works, O Lord!
Your [bq](FR)thoughts are very (FS)deep.
A (FT)senseless man has no knowledge,
Nor does a (FU)stupid man understand this:
That when the wicked (FV)sprouted up like grass
And all (FW)who did iniquity flourished,
It was only that they might be (FX)destroyed forevermore.
But You, O Lord, are (FY)on high forever.
For, behold, Your enemies, O Lord,
For, behold, (FZ)Your enemies will perish;
All who do iniquity will be (GA)scattered.

10 But You have exalted my (GB)horn like that of the wild ox;
I have [br]been (GC)anointed with fresh oil.
11 And my eye has (GD)looked exultantly upon [bs]my foes,
My ears hear of the evildoers who rise up against me.
12 The (GE)righteous man will [bt]flourish like the palm tree,
He will grow like a (GF)cedar in Lebanon.
13 (GG)Planted in the house of the Lord,
They will flourish (GH)in the courts of our God.
14 They will still [bu](GI)yield fruit in old age;
They shall be [bv]full of sap and very green,
15 To [bw]declare that (GJ)the Lord is upright;
He is my (GK)rock, and there is (GL)no unrighteousness in Him.

The Majesty of the Lord.

93 (GM)The Lord [bx]reigns, He is (GN)clothed with majesty;
The Lord has (GO)clothed and girded Himself with strength;
Indeed, the (GP)world is firmly established, it will not be moved.
Your (GQ)throne is established from of old;
You (GR)are from everlasting.

The (GS)floods have lifted up, O Lord,
The floods have lifted up their voice,
The floods lift up their pounding waves.
More than the sounds of many waters,
Than the mighty breakers of the sea,
The Lord (GT)on high is mighty.
Your (GU)testimonies are fully confirmed;
(GV)Holiness befits Your house,
O Lord, [by]forevermore.

The Lord Implored to Avenge His People.

94 O Lord, God of [bz](GW)vengeance,
God of [ca]vengeance, [cb](GX)shine forth!
(GY)Rise up, O (GZ)Judge of the earth,
Render recompense (HA)to the proud.
How long shall the wicked, O Lord,
How long shall the (HB)wicked exult?
They pour forth words, they (HC)speak arrogantly;
All who do wickedness (HD)vaunt themselves.
They (HE)crush Your people, O Lord,
And (HF)afflict Your heritage.
They (HG)slay the widow and the [cc]stranger
And murder the orphans.
(HH)They have said, “[cd]The Lord does not see,
Nor does the God of Jacob pay heed.”

Pay heed, you (HI)senseless among the people;
And when will you understand, (HJ)stupid ones?
He who (HK)planted the ear, [ce]does He not hear?
He who formed the eye, [cf]does He not see?
10 He who [cg](HL)chastens the nations, will He not rebuke,
Even He who (HM)teaches man knowledge?
11 The Lord (HN)knows the thoughts of man,
[ch]That they are a mere breath.

12 Blessed is the man whom (HO)You chasten, O [ci]Lord,
And (HP)whom You teach out of Your law;
13 That You may grant him (HQ)relief from the (HR)days of adversity,
Until (HS)a pit is dug for the wicked.
14 For (HT)the Lord will not abandon His people,
Nor will He (HU)forsake His inheritance.
15 For [cj](HV)judgment [ck]will again be righteous,
And all the upright in heart [cl]will follow it.
16 Who will (HW)stand up for me against evildoers?
Who will take his stand for me (HX)against those who do wickedness?

17 If (HY)the Lord had not been my help,
My soul would soon have dwelt in the abode of silence.
18 If I should say, “(HZ)My foot has slipped,”
Your lovingkindness, O Lord, will hold me up.
19 When my anxious thoughts [cm]multiply within me,
Your (IA)consolations delight my soul.
20 Can a [cn](IB)throne of destruction be allied with You,
One (IC)which devises [co]mischief by decree?
21 They (ID)band themselves together against the [cp]life of the righteous
And (IE)condemn [cq]the innocent to death.
22 But the Lord has been my (IF)stronghold,
And my God the (IG)rock of my refuge.
23 He has (IH)brought back their wickedness upon them
And will [cr](II)destroy them in their evil;
The Lord our God will [cs]destroy them.
